About Sustainable Finance Law in Dhaka, Bangladesh

Sustainable finance refers to the process of taking environmental, social, and governance (ESG) considerations into account when making investment and financing decisions. In Dhaka, Bangladesh, this area of law is becoming increasingly important, as governmental and financial institutions encourage responsible investing and aim to support projects that promote long-term benefits for society and the environment. Sustainable finance law refers to the local and international legal frameworks that regulate how banks, financial institutions, businesses, and investors can support sustainable growth and ensure compliance with ESG standards.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

You may need a lawyer with expertise in sustainable finance for several reasons. Some common situations include:

  • Understanding regulatory requirements when seeking financing or investment for green and social projects.
  • Navigating sustainability disclosure requirements imposed by Bangladeshi regulators, such as the Bangladesh Securities and Exchange Commission (BSEC) or Bangladesh Bank.
  • Ensuring compliance with both domestic and international ESG standards for banks, corporations, or investors.
  • Structuring green bonds, sustainability-linked loans, or impact investments.
  • Dealing with disputes or allegations of greenwashing or ESG misrepresentation.
  • Managing risks related to environmental and social impact assessments required for projects in Bangladesh.
  • Advising on tax incentives or government programs available to sustainable finance projects.

Local Laws Overview

Sustainable finance is guided by various environmental, financial, and corporate laws in Bangladesh. Some of the critical legal frameworks and guidelines in Dhaka include:

  • Bangladesh Bank’s Sustainable Finance Policy: This policy provides banks and financial institutions with detailed guidelines for financing environmentally friendly and socially responsible projects, as well as reporting requirements.
  • Environment Conservation Act, 1995 and Environment Rules, 1997: These require environmental impact assessments for major projects, which often intersect with sustainable finance initiatives.
  • BSEC Guidelines: The Bangladesh Securities and Exchange Commission has introduced regulations for green bonds, sustainability reporting, and responsible investing.
  • Financial Reporting Council (FRC) Guidance: This regulatory body encourages transparent reporting and the inclusion of ESG factors in financial disclosures.
  • International Treaties and Standards: Many projects in Bangladesh align with international protocols such as the Equator Principles and the United Nations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s), which shape local industry standards.

Frequently Asked Questions

What exactly is sustainable finance?

Sustainable finance involves financing activities and making investment decisions that consider environmental, social, and governance criteria. It promotes long-term economic growth while safeguarding ecological balance and social well-being.

Do I need legal advice before applying for a green loan or issuing a green bond?

Yes, legal guidance is essential to understand eligibility criteria, ensure compliance with relevant regulations, and structure documentation properly to meet both lender and regulator expectations.

What regulations govern sustainable finance in Dhaka, Bangladesh?

Key regulations include the Bangladesh Bank’s Sustainable Finance Policy, BSEC’s green bond framework, environmental laws, and international sustainability standards relevant to financiers and corporations operating in Bangladesh.

What is ESG and why is it important in sustainable finance?

ESG stands for Environmental, Social, and Governance criteria. These factors help lenders and investors assess the long-term risk and impact of a project or company, shaping the direction of sustainable finance activities.

Can foreign investors participate in sustainable finance projects in Bangladesh?

Yes, foreign investors can participate, but they must comply with local laws, foreign investment regulations, and ESG disclosure requirements. Legal assistance can help navigate these frameworks and mitigate cross-border risks.

How are disputes handled if there is a disagreement about ESG compliance?

Disputes can be resolved through negotiation, mediation, or legal proceedings. A lawyer can advise on dispute resolution mechanisms and representation in regulatory or court matters.

Is disclosure or reporting required for sustainable finance activities?

Yes, reporting and disclosure are required by regulators such as Bangladesh Bank and BSEC. These disclosures ensure transparency, prevent greenwashing, and build trust with investors and the public.

Are there incentives or tax benefits for pursuing sustainable finance?

The government and regulatory bodies may offer incentives such as tax breaks, concessional financing, or grants for projects that align with sustainable development objectives. Legal professionals can help identify and secure these benefits.

What documentations are needed for a sustainable finance project?

Essential documents include environmental and social impact assessments, sustainability reports, legal compliance certificates, loan or bond agreements, and disclosures demonstrating alignment with ESG criteria.

Who oversees sustainable finance practices in Bangladesh?

Bodies such as Bangladesh Bank, the Bangladesh Securities and Exchange Commission, the Financial Reporting Council, and relevant environmental authorities oversee and enforce sustainable finance practices in the country.

Additional Resources

If you want more information or guidance on sustainable finance in Dhaka, consider the following resources:

  • Bangladesh Bank Sustainable Finance Department: Provides policy documents, circulars, and guidance on sustainable finance for financial institutions.
  • Bangladesh Securities and Exchange Commission (BSEC): Regulatory body for capital market activities, including green bonds and sustainability disclosures.
  • Financial Reporting Council (FRC) Bangladesh: Issues accounting and reporting standards for ESG matters.
  • Department of Environment (DoE): Oversees environmental compliance and permitting for projects.
  • Bangladesh Association of Banks and Industry Groups: Offer seminars and best practice guidelines on ESG in finance.
